Banff National Park. Length: 6.7 mi • Est. 4h 31m. The Sulphur Mountain Trail is highly recommended if this is your first time in Banff National Park! This route goes up alpine switchbacks to the summit of Sulphur Mountain and features incredible views of Bow Valley. This is a great and moderately challenging hike - the elevation gain will ... Sulphur Mountain (near Banff town) One such hike takes you up Sulphur Mountain, a steep, but moderate 6.3 mile out and back trail rising 2,400 feet and accessible right from downtown Banff. It’s a tough one, but it’s one of the most scenic hiking trails in Canada! Watch the sunset on a riverside stroll or feel the breath of glaciers in the alpine. Take your pick of over 1,600 kilometres (1,000 miles) of maintained trails. Many of the park’s most famous hikes are easily accessible from the Town of Banff and the village of Lake Louise. Prime hiking season runs July through mid-September. Healy Pass trail is a long and steady hike up a mild incline on a well-maintained trail. Johnson Lake Loop Trail. Located just outside of Banff, Johnson Lake Loop Trail is an easy 3.4-kilometer hike around the picturesque Johnson Lake.
